K K Silk Mills IPO

K K Silk Mills IPO, a SME IPO of ₹27.08 Cr opens for subscription from November 26, 2025 to November 28, 2025. The IPO consists of ₹27.08 Cr fresh issue.

The face value of each share is 10, and the price band is set between 36.00-38.00 per share. The tentative listing date on the exchange (BSE SME) is December 3, 2025

K K Silk Mills IPO offers total 75,00,000 shares. Out of which 72,000 allocated to QIB, – allocated to QIB (Ex- Anchor), 10,71,000 (14.28%) allocated to NII 59,82,000 (79.76%) allocated to RII.

About the Company

K K Silk Mills Limited, established in August 1991, is engaged in the manufacturing of both fabrics and garments. The company offers a wide range of products across kids’, men’s, and women’s wear.

The company produces fabrics used in various applications, including men’s shirts, formal and casual wear, sherwani material, ladies’ dress material, burkha fabric, and cushion cover material. Its product portfolio also includes suiting and shirting fabrics, corporate wear, men’s wear, and ready-made garments, all designed to meet high quality standards and enhance customer style.

K K Silk Mills operates a state-of-the-art manufacturing unit located in Umbergaon, Valsad, Gujarat, spread across 5,422 sq. ft. The facility has a combined installed production capacity of 20 million meters for fabrics and garments.

As of 31 March 2025, the manufacturing units employ 169 workers, and the company’s total workforce stands at 191 employees, including 26 contract workers. The company also supports local employment, with women from nearby villages working at its facilities.

Investors tracking K K Silk Mills IPO GMP Today also monitor unofficial grey market indicators. GMP represents the market’s expectation of listing gains before official listing, though it is not regulated and may vary significantly across sources. It should be treated as indicative, not definitive.
